ASIA/INDONESIA - Appointment of the Bishop of the Diocese of Pangkalpinang

Wednesday, 28 June 2017

Vatican City (Agenzia Fides) – Today the Holy Father appointed Fr. Adrianus Sunarko, O.F.M., Provincial Superior and President of the Conference of Male Major Superiors in Indonesia, as Bishop of the Diocese of Pangkalpinang (Indonesia).
The new Bishop was born on December 7, 1966 in Merauke in the Archdiocese of Merauke, Papua Occidental. After attending the Minor Seminary of Mertoyudan, he completed his philosophical studies at the High School of Philosophy Driyarkara in Jakarta and the theological studies at the Wedabhakti Pontifical Faculty of Theology in Yogyakarta. He gave his perpetual vows on August 15, 1994 in the Order of Friars Minor and was ordained a priest on July 8, 1995.
He then held the following offices and academc roles: 1995-1996: Parish Vicar in Kramat (Archdiocese of Jakarta); 1996-2002: Studies in Theology at the Albert-Ludwig Universität in Freiburg, Germany; Since 2002: Professor at the Driyarkara Philosophical High School in Jakarta; 2007-2009: Vice-Provincial of the OFM for Indonesia; Since 2010: Superior of the OFM Province for Indonesia (two mandates); Since 2014: President of KOPTARI (Conference of Major Male Superiors).
The diocese of Pangkalpinang (1961), a suffragan of the archdiocese of Palembang, has an area of 30,442 sq km and a population of 3,345,000 inhabitants, of whom 58,000 are Catholics. There are 14 parishes, 76 priests (61 diocesan and 15 religious), 78 nuns, and 15 seminarians. (SL) (Agenzia Fides, 28/6/2017)
